SpecificationDeliver high-acuity prehospital and interfacility care within a multidisciplinary EMS system.
Lead rapid assessment, advanced life support, and safe patient transport while upholding clinical governance, safety, and service standards.
Key Responsibilities- Perform advanced life support : airway management (including supraglottic / advanced techniques), ventilation, cardiac arrest care, 12-lead ECG interpretation, pharmacologic interventions, IV / IO access, analgesia / sedation per protocol.
- Manage trauma and medical emergencies across adult and pediatric populations (e.g., DKA / HHS, ACS, stroke, polytrauma).
- Conduct scene leadership : dynamic risk assessment, triage (single- and multi-casualty), bystander / crew coordination, and handover using structured tools.
- Execute interfacility transfers, including critical care transports, monitoring and titrating therapies en route.
- Use ePCR systems for accurate, timely documentation; participate in audits, morbidity reviews, and QI initiatives.
- Maintain vehicle / kit readiness : daily checks, medication / fridge logs, infection-prevention protocols, PPE, and equipment troubleshooting.
- Communicate with dispatch, receiving facilities, and medical oversight; escaltate per clinical guidelines.
- Mentor junior staff and contribute to training, simulations, and competency validation.
- Work a rotating schedule (days / nights / weekends / holidays) in varied environments and weather.
